Market Size Overview

  • Total Addressable Market (TAM): Estimated at approximately USD 2.5 billion in 2023, reflecting the global demand for industrial-grade switching power supplies, with Japan accounting for roughly 20-25% due to its advanced manufacturing sector and high industrial automation adoption.
  • Serviceable Available Market (SAM): Focused on the segments within Japan and select high-growth regions, estimated at USD 500 million, considering the penetration in sectors such as factory automation, transportation, and renewable energy infrastructure.
  • Serviceable Obtainable Market (SOM): Realistically capturing USD 150-200 million within the next 3-5 years, based on current market share, competitive positioning, and growth initiatives.

Segmentation Logic and Boundaries

  • Application Segments: Factory automation, transportation (rail, EV charging), renewable energy (solar, wind), medical equipment, and industrial machinery.
  • Customer Types: OEMs, system integrators, end-users in manufacturing, and government infrastructure projects.
  • Geographic Boundaries: Japan as the primary market, with potential expansion into Asia-Pacific regions where Japanese technology standards influence local markets.

Adoption Rates and Penetration Scenarios

  • Current adoption rate in core sectors is approximately 30%, with a projected increase to 45% over the next 5 years due to technological upgrades and regulatory mandates.
  • Market penetration is expected to accelerate driven by Industry 4.0 initiatives, smart manufacturing, and increased emphasis on energy efficiency.
  • Growth potential is amplified by the rising demand for high-reliability, energy-efficient power supplies in critical infrastructure.

Operational Challenges & Bottlenecks

  • Supply chain disruptions affecting component availability, especially semiconductors.
  • High R&D costs associated with developing next-generation, compliant products.
  • Regulatory compliance timelines, including certifications such as UL, CE, and Japan’s PSE standards.
  • Scaling manufacturing capacity without compromising quality or delivery timelines.

Regulatory Landscape & Certification Timelines

  • Mandatory safety and energy efficiency standards are evolving, requiring proactive compliance strategies.
  • Certification processes typically span 6-12 months, necessitating early engagement with regulatory bodies.
  • Alignment with international standards enhances export potential and market credibility.

Technological Innovations & Product Launches

  • Introduction of high-efficiency, compact power supplies leveraging GaN (Gallium Nitride) and SiC (Silicon Carbide) semiconductors.
  • Integration of IoT capabilities for remote monitoring, predictive maintenance, and smart grid integration.
  • Development of modular, scalable power supply architectures to support diverse industrial applications.
